Ford Fiesta: Climate Control System - General Information / Passenger Side Register. Removal and Installation

Special Tool(s) / General Equipment

Interior Trim Remover

Removal

NOTE: Removal steps in this procedure may contain installation details.

  1. Remove the passenger side register assembly.
    Use the General Equipment: Interior Trim Remover

Installation

  1. To install, reverse the removal procedure.
